WebTo find the gradient use the fact that the tangent is perpendicular to the radius from the point it meets the circle. Work out the gradient of the radius (CP) at the point the … WebThe tangent is perpendicular to the radius which joins the centre of the circle to the point P. Therefore howard stern britney murphyWeb4 de set. de 2024 · A tangent to a circle is a line which intersects the circle in exactly one point. In Figure 1 line A B ↔ is a tangent, intersecting circle O just at point P. Figure 1. A B ↔ is tangent to circle O at point P.
